Had a puncture last night on one of the front wheels. Changed over to the space saver but it was locked against the brake caliper.
The car originally came with two pot brakes but has been upgraded to the later 4 pots.
Did later cars come with different space savers or are you supposed to put the space saver on the back and put a rear wheel on the front?
